Hi Manchester Free Software folks,

As you might know the GNOME project’s annual European conference will
be taking place in Manchester this year between 28th July and 2nd
August.  The conference will provide an opportunity to find out about
the latest technical developments in the GNOME desktop environment, to
learn new skills and tools, attend talks and participate in workshops
and discussions.  Everyone is welcome to attend – see the GUADEC 2017
website at https://www.guadec.org/ for more details.

The conference is now open for registration and we are also accepting
talk submissions until 23rd April.

You don’t have to be an existing member of the GNOME project to submit
a talk: if you have something interesting to say about software or
technology, we want to hear from you!

Subjects that we are particularly interested in include:

 * Design of user and developer experiences
 * Operating system plumbing
 * Application development and deployment
 * Use of GNOME technologies outside the desktop
 * Outreach to new contributors
 * Project organisation and governance
 * Privacy and security
 * Developments in open source/Free Software
 * The GNOME developer experience

Talks can be either 25 or 40 minutes in length, which includes time for
questions.
